Vue中的concat()是JavaScript中的數組方法之一,在Vue中同樣也可以使用該方法將兩個或多個數組合并為一個數組。concat()方法不會修改現有數組,而是返回一個新數組,該新數組包含現有數組的元素。這個方法可以將任意數量的數組合并在一起,使用時只需要傳遞需要合并的數組即可。
// 數組合并 let array1 = [1, 2, 3]; let array2 = [4, 5, 6]; let newArray = array1.concat(array2); console.log(newArray); // [1, 2, 3, 4, 5, 6]
在Vue中,我們可以使用concat()方法將兩個或多個數組合并為一個數組。例如,我們可以使用該方法將兩個數組連接起來,并在一個v-for循環中渲染這個數組:
// Vue中使用數組合并 data() { return { array1: [1, 2, 3], array2: [4, 5, 6] } }, computed: { newArray() { return this.array1.concat(this.array2); } }
現在,我們可以通過渲染newArray來顯示合并后的數組:
<div v-for="item in newArray" :key="item">{{ item }}
總之,concat()方法是Vue中一個非常有用的方法,可以讓我們輕松將多個數組合并成一個數組,從而方便地處理數組數據。